What is a Wiring Diagram?
A wiring diagram is a basic visual representation of the physical connections and physical design of an electrical system or circuit. It shows how the electrical wires are adjoined and where components and parts may be connected to the system.

Distinction between wiring diagram, schematic, and Pictorial diagram
A schematic shows the plan and function of an electrical circuit but is not concerned with the physical design of the wires. Wiring diagrams show how the wires are connected, where they must be found in the device and the physical connections in between all the parts.
Unlike a pictorial diagram, a wiring diagram uses abstract or streamlined shapes and lines to show elements. Pictorial diagrams are often images with labels or highly-detailed drawings of the physical parts.

How is wire numbered?
American Wire Gauge (AWG) is the standard way to represent wire size in North America. In AWG, the bigger the number, the smaller the wire diameter and density. The largest basic size is 0000 AWG, and 40 AWG is the smallest basic size.
How do you read electrical wire numbers?
An electrical cable is categorized by two numbers separated by a hyphen, such as 14-2. The first number signifies the conductor’s gauge; the 2nd signifies the number of conductors inside the cable. 14-2 has 2 14-gauge conductors: a hot and a neutral.
